Her sire Sir Sinclair won the Get of Sire class at the prestigious Dressage at Devon Breed Show an unprecedented four consecutive times from 2006-2009. He is the sire of an Approved stallion, as well as winning FEI horses, breed show champions and Star and Keur mares, Winclair being one. In 2011, four Sir offspring were named KWPN-NA North American Champions in both dressage and hunter divisions, showing his impressive versatility as a sire. Honest, reliable, with an excellent temperament and character, he is friendly, easy going, and very willing to work. Sir Sinclair has always been a quick learner and has a natural aptitude for dressage.

FARN
Sire: FAX I Dam: DORETTE
Farn was a legendary preferent stallion of mainly Holsteiner blood and is one of the most influential 'founding' sires of the Dutch Warmblood. Farn was born in Holstein and descends from the Achill or 'F' line that began in 1877. Next to the Ethelbert line, it is the oldest Holsteiner stallion line.

Farn was used by the Dutch to improve their sporthorses, primarily their jumping horses. The valuable qualities that Farn bestowed on his dressage decendants were power and ability and a strong will. He is found in the pedigree of Olympic Ferro. Farn is considered to be one of the fathers of the modern Dutch sporthorse in both the dressage and jumper disciplines.

He is considered to be a foundation stallion of modern Dutch warmblood breeding that was well represented through his approved sons, which includes the world renowned Dutch stallion Nimmerdor, who was honored as stallion of the century in 2000. Farn, although old fashioned in type, created outstanding modern types when crossed with lighter type mares. Most of his offspring were noted to be exceptional jumpers.

Flemmingh (Lacapo x Texas)

The KWPN named Flemmingh the highest ranking of 'Preferent' for his contribution to the Dutch Warmblood breeding in Holland.

Flemmingh's mare line is one of the best available in Holstein. Flemmingh sires beautiful, big, long-lined horses with three perfect gaits. This is proven by the great number of Ster and Keur mares, champion foals and dressage performance horses.

His offspring are performing very well at the National and International dressage shows. His son Lingh, ridden by Edward Gal, was Reserve Champion of Holland, he won the World Cup in Amsterdam and was Reserve Champion at the World Cup Final in Las Vegas, where he was the crowd favorite. He won and placed in several other Grand Prix and World Cup qualifiers. He was also a member of the Dutch team at the European Championship. Flemmingh’s approved son Krack C has also won several Grand Prix and was the best KWPN dressage horse during the World Championship in Jerez 2002. Krack C won the Grand Prix Special in ’s Hertogenbosch and became the Dutch Dressage Champion of 2005. Also very successful is BeSe, ridden by Catherina Morelli, who won the Grand Prix Special and the Grand Prix at the International Horse Show in Palm Beach. Melvin, who is with Imke Schellekens-Bartels, has already placed 2nd twice in a Grand Prix and was 4th at the Dutch Championship 2006.

Flemmingh was an internationally appreciated dressage stallion and his offspring are very much in demand by dressage riders, trainers and dealers worldwide because they are very eager learners, long lined modern types with superior work ethic and big fancy movement.
